Viewing and Changing Radio Settings
283
Viewing and
Changing Radio
Settings
You can configure MAP radio settings when you configure the MAPs.
You also can view or change radio settings after the MAPs are
configured.
Viewing Radio
Settings
To view radio settings:
1
Select the Configuration tool bar option.
2
In the Organizer panel, click the plus sign next to the WX switch.
3
Click the plus sign next to Wireless.
4
Select
Radios
.
The radio settings appear in the Content panel. Each row in the table
shows settings for an individual radio.
To display all settings for a radio, select the radio and click
Properties
.
Changing Radio
Settings
To change radio settings:
1
Access the radio table:
a
Select the Configuration tool bar option.
b
In the Organizer panel, click the plus sign next to the WX switch.
c
Click the plus sign next to Wireless.
d
Select
Radios
.
2
To change basic radio settings, select the new values in the table. To
change more advanced features, select the radio and click
Properties
.

3
If you edit settings in the table, click
Save
. If you configure settings in the
Radio Properties wizard, clicking
OK
to close the wizard also saves the
changes.
